From bee800c2dd53119dc26dde205a74fa9c4e1fddce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?S=C3=A9bastien=20GLON?= Date: Tue, 6 Aug 2024 14:40:39 +0200 Subject: [PATCH] fix(securityGroup): create group whit flag extraSecurityGroupRule --- controllers/osccluster_securitygroup_controller.go |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) diff --git a/controllers/osccluster_securitygroup_controller.go b/controllers/osccluster_securitygroup_controller.go index 2e5a99270..55b28bc00 100644 --- a/controllers/osccluster_securitygroup_controller.go +++ b/controllers/osccluster_securitygroup_controller.go @@ -297,8 +297,7 @@ func reconcileSecurityGroup(ctx context.Context, clusterScope *scope.ClusterScop securityGroupId := securityGroupsRef.ResourceMap[securityGroupName] if !Contains(securityGroupIds, securityGroupId) && tag == nil { - - if extraSecurityGroupRule { + if extraSecurityGroupRule && (len(securityGroupsRef.ResourceMap) == len(securityGroupsSpec)) { clusterScope.V(4).Info("Extra Security Group Rule activated") } else { clusterScope.V(2).Info("Create the desired securitygroup", "securityGroupName", securityGroupName)